Hide your Caller ID for outgoing calls

Hide your name and phone number on outgoing calls with AT&T Phone and AT&T Phone - Advanced.


AT&T Phone – Advanced

  1. Go to the AT&T phone portal. Sign in with your member ID.
  2. Select Features, then Outgoing Calls.
  3. Expand Hide My Caller ID, then toggle it ON or OFF.
  4. Select Save.

Additional tips

If Hide My Caller ID is:

  • Enabled: You can hide your phone number to be displayed for a single outgoing call. Press *67, dial the destination phone number, then press #.
  • Disabled: You can unhide your Caller ID for a single outgoing call. Press *82, dial the number, then press #.

AT&T Phone

  1. Go to your myAT&T account overview and select My digital phone.
  2. Select My voicemail & phone features, then Phone Features.
  3. In the Outgoing Calls section, select Caller ID Blocking.
    • Select ON to enable Caller ID Blocking.
    • Select OFF to disable Caller ID Blocking.
  4. Select Save.

Additional info

  • If Caller ID Blocking is enabled, you can allow your phone number to be displayed for just one call. Press *82, dial the number, then press #.
  • If Caller ID Blocking is disabled, you can block your phone number from being displayed for just one call. Press *67, dial the number, then press #.
